Q9(i):

A brooch is made with silver wire in the form of a circle with diameter 35 mm. The wire is also used in making 5 diameters which divide the circle into 10 equal sectors as shown in Fig. 11.9. Find : (i) the total length of the silver wire required. (Unless stated otherwise, use $\pi = \frac{22}{7}$)

Solution :

Given:

1. The brooch is circular in shape.
2. The diameter of the circle ($d$) = $35\text{ mm}$.
3. The number of diameters used to divide the circle = $5$.
4. The value of $\pi = \frac{22}{7}$.

To Find:

The total length of the silver wire required to make the brooch.

Diameter = 35 mm

Step 1: Calculate the circumference of the circle.

The silver wire forms the outer boundary (circumference) of the circle. The formula for the circumference ($C$) of a circle is given by:
$C = \pi \times d$
Substituting the given values:
$C = \frac{22}{7} \times 35\text{ mm}$
$C = 22 \times 5\text{ mm}$ [Since $35 \div 7 = 5$]
$C = 110\text{ mm}$

Step 2: Calculate the length of the 5 diameters.

The wire is also used to make 5 diameters. The length of one diameter is $35\text{ mm}$.
Total length of 5 diameters = $5 \times d$
Total length of 5 diameters = $5 \times 35\text{ mm}$
Total length of 5 diameters = $175\text{ mm}$

Step 3: Calculate the total length of the silver wire.

The total length of the wire required is the sum of the circumference of the circle and the length of the 5 diameters.
Total Length = Circumference + (5 $\times$ Diameter)
Total Length = $110\text{ mm} + 175\text{ mm}$
Total Length = $285\text{ mm}$

Final Answer: The total length of the silver wire required is 285 mm.
